
NecroVisioN: Lost Company
TL;DR
It is a horror FPS shooter set during World War I where players fight against zombies and demons. The game serves as a prequel to the original, featuring new levels, characters, and gameplay elements. Players take on the role of a German soldier discovering evil forces unleashed by the war.

Conclusion
Overall, 'NecroVisioN: Lost Company' is viewed as a significant improvement over its predecessor, with engaging action and a variety of enemies. However, it suffers from technical issues and a short playtime, which may affect player satisfaction. The game has garnered mixed reactions regarding its gameplay mechanics and story, with many players enjoying the nostalgic elements while others express frustration over bugs and AI problems.
Strongly Positive
Improved Gameplay
Many players noted that this game is a significant improvement over its predecessor, offering better mechanics and pacing.
Fun Action
Players enjoyed the fast-paced action and engaging combat, often comparing it favorably to classic shooters.
Positive
Variety of Enemies
The game features a diverse range of enemies, which keeps the gameplay fresh and exciting.
Interesting Story
Some players appreciated the storyline and its connection to the original game, finding it engaging despite some clichés.
Graphics and Atmosphere
The graphics were generally well-received, with players noting that they have aged well and contribute to the game's atmosphere.
Neutral / Mixed Opinions
Negative
Short Playtime
Several reviews mentioned the game's relatively short length, which may disappoint some players looking for a longer experience.
Repetitive Gameplay
Some players found the gameplay to be repetitive, with certain mechanics and enemy encounters becoming tedious over time.
AI Issues
Players criticized the enemy AI for being poorly designed, often leading to frustrating encounters.
Chaotic Combat
The overwhelming number of enemies at times led to chaotic gameplay that some players found frustrating.
Strongly Negative
Bugs and Technical Issues
Many players reported encountering bugs and technical problems that detracted from their overall experience.
